Spurs whiz Alli keen on reunion with Crystal Palace ace Puncheon

Tottenham winger Dele Alli is looking forward to a reunion with Crystal Palace midfielder Jason Puncheon.

Just five years ago he was cleaning boots in Milton Keynes while Puncheon was tearing up League One.

Alli, a £5m signing from the Dons, said: "He was definitely a player I looked up to because he was really exciting to watch.

"When he was at MK he was a great player and everybody thought he was the best player there.

"He is showing how good he is now in the Premier League. I was cleaning the boots and stuff at that time. He was a really good player and we always used to speak about how good he was.

"I didn't clean his boots. I got put on the gaffer's boots, so it was good. It's going to be a bit weird seeing him, obviously, but I am looking forward to the challenge if I get picked."
